Ticket #—: Vault locked, Hargrove telemetry gateway down

Hey on-call — the credentials vault for the Furrowlink gateway sealed itself after last night's power blip at the Dunmoor site, so the farm-equipment telemetry feed is dead. Tractors are buffering data locally, so nothing's lost yet, but we've got maybe six hours before the buffers roll over. Restart steps are in the Furrowlink runbook; the vault itself won't unseal without operator input. To complete the unseal, enter the recovery passphrase.

unlock words, tawif-tahop: oliys-ulawyn-tamdor-lamys-casox-jormir-fraius-kasath-ulador-ulamir-holir-sorys-holeth

Handover — Brindlecore logging

Quick context: the Oxhollow ingest service logs every request at debug, which swamped the aggregator last sprint. We enabled head-based sampling at 5% with full capture on errors. Don't raise the rate without checking aggregator quota first. Dashboards already account for the sampling factor. The sampling configuration in effect today is shown below.

service settings:
ZOROX_LOG_LEVEL=info
ZOROX_METRICS_HOST=metrics.zorox.tolvaqsys.internal
ZOROX_POOL_SIZE=4

## Session Handling for Health Checks

The Corvel gateway sits behind the Lanternside load balancer, which probes /healthz every ten seconds. Health-check requests are stateless by design: they bypass the session store entirely so that probe traffic never inflates session counts or evicts real user sessions. New team members should note that the deep-check endpoint, /healthz/deep, does verify session-store connectivity and therefore requires authentication. When probing it manually, supply the token below.

bearer token for tajep-kajef: eyJhbGciOiJIUzI1NiIsInR5cCI6IkpXVCJ9.eyJzdWIiOiIoOsZ23In0.CsygO0hs